Arkansas vs Utah Electricity Rates (2026)

Utah has 12.5% cheaper electricity than Arkansas. Utah residents pay 11.41¢/kWh compared to 13.04¢/kWh in Arkansas, saving about $36.00/month on average.

Bottom Line: Arkansas vs Utah

Utah is the more affordable state for electricity, with rates 12.5% lower than Arkansas. An average household would save about $432.00/year by living in Utah.

Arkansas gets its electricity primarily from Natural Gas with 10.0% renewable, while Utah relies on Coal with 16.0% renewable.
